Every year, as the sun shifts into Aquarius from January 19 to February 18, we enter a time of big ideas, individuality, and connection. Aquarius is the fixed air sign of the zodiac, and its arrival brings a breath of fresh air—clearing out stale energy and inviting us to think outside the box.
Aquarius, ruled by Uranus and symbolized by the water-bearer, is all about innovation, collective progress, and embracing who you truly are. As a fixed sign, Aquarius energy encourages us to stay focused on our vision, no matter how unconventional it might seem, and to focus on how our individual efforts contribute to the greater good of humanity.
